    Today, I revisited the famous Gillette Techmatic band razor. I first used one of these back in the 60s. I was not impressed with it then. However, today's shave was as good as it gets. Technique trumps tools. In the 60s, I had the tools but not the technique. There you go... I really did not know what to expect, but I was pleasantly surprised with this shave.

    My prep was just a cold water rinse. The Green Mountain Lime Vetiver Shaving Soap face lathered well with B-400 by Tom brush. I did two passes with the Gillette Techmatic razor with a Techmatic Band SE blade and ended up with a close, comfortable shave. After a cold water rinse, I finished off with Granddad's Blend AS. I am clean, smooth, and refreshed...
